Arquiste · 2013
Mare Rubrum
EDPUnisex
The Story
Mare Rubrum is a salty, aquatic scent that captures the essence of the Red Sea. It opens with a sharp burst of sea salt and lemon, then settles into a heart of seaweed and iris. The base is a warm blend of ambergris and driftwood, evoking the feeling of sun-baked shores. It's a unique take on marine fragrances, avoiding the typical calone-heavy approach.

Encyclopedia Insights
Is Mare Rubrum a typical fresh aquatic?+
No, it's more mineral and salty than fresh. It avoids the sweet melon or cucumber notes common in many aquatics.
How does the seaweed note smell?+
It's realistic, like dried seaweed on the beach, not overly fishy. It adds a briny, earthy quality.
Is this unisex?+
Yes, it works well for anyone who enjoys salty, mineral scents. It's not traditionally masculine or feminine.
